# deke

> English word · Noun · IPA /diːk/ · frequency rank #57,330

## Definitions
1. A feint, fake, or other move made by the player with the puck to deceive a goaltender or defenceman.
2. As in hockey, a fake or other move to confuse other players on a team.
3. A quick detour.

## Etymology
Canadian English, a contraction of decoy.
